An informal meeting to discuss forming a new strut in the York (UK) area is going ahead at Full Sutton on Sat 22nd 1pm.
Anyone interested will be more than welcome.

The meeting went ahead and we had 18 attend. It was decided to apply to the LAA to form a Strut. We have now approximately 25 "members" and as soon as we get approval from the LAA we will move forward from there.
